Indonesia’s large-market enterprise AI landscape
Indonesia’s enterprise AI opportunity is scale-shaped: hundreds of millions of consumers, sprawling conglomerate structures, rapid digital banking and fintech growth, and manufacturing and resources groups modernising back offices faster than governance keeps up. AI consulting Indonesia searches at enterprise level are overwhelmingly English-first — group CIOs, regional CFOs, and digital leads in Jakarta negotiate with global vendors in English — yet customer-facing, HR, and field workflows require Bahasa Indonesia quality and locale realism that English-only pilots ignore.
What distinguishes Indonesia from smaller ASEAN peers is organisational complexity plus regulatory evolution. Personal Data Protection Law (UU PDP) implementation creates privacy expectations that legal teams now treat as design inputs, not post-pilot cleanup. Financial services and payment adjacents face BI and OJK-aligned scrutiny on outsourcing and customer outcomes. Conglomerates run dozens of subsidiaries with different IT maturity — a group AI strategy that assumes uniform readiness fails when spoke entities lack APIs, master data, or named owners.
Stall patterns are large-market familiar. A Jakarta HQ funds a generative pilot showcased to the board while subsidiary IT blocks integration for six months. A bank experiments with chatbots without Bahasa quality review or escalation paths to human agents. A retail or logistics group buys global platform licences while store-level approvals still run on informal channels. Another: shadow use of consumer AI tools spreads through marketing and product teams before infosec completes inventory — then everything freezes at audit. Talent exists in Jakarta and Bandung tech hubs but conglomerates compete with unicorns and global tech for the same senior hires; they need remote-capable advisors who deliver evidence-first without inventing a Sudirman address.
